## Further Reading

If you are new to how Brindlewave routes traffic, please take time to understand our health check setup before touching any service configs. The Lattice load balancer probes each backend every five seconds, and a misconfigured readiness endpoint can silently drain a whole pool. We have seen this cause partial outages twice, so the nuances matter. The full health check design notes and probe tuning guide live on our internal wiki.

runbook for badug-kadup: https://confluence.zemvarlabs.internal/projects/browse/display/projects/bd1b

## Deploying the Gatewick Proctor Queue

Deploys are pretty painless: push to main, wait for the pipeline, then watch the queue drain dashboard for five minutes. If candidates pile up mid-exam, roll back first and ask questions later — the queue replays safely. Everything the workers care about lives in one config block, shown here for reference.

settings of bafof-yagef:
JOROX_PIN=8740
JOROX_TENANT=pelox
JOROX_METRICS_HOST=metrics.jorox.qorvelworks.internal
JOROX_SEAL=seal_c78f63c1
JOROX_STANDBY_TEAM=norax

Handover — from R. Ashvale to D. Merrow, Director of Operations, Tollis & Fane. Finance team: the Harwick Street lease renegotiation is mid-stream. Landlord countered at a 9% uplift; our ceiling is 4%. Break clause expires in ten weeks. All correspondence sits in the Property folder; surveyor's report due next week. Keep provisioning at current rent until signed. The confidential note below covers how this ties into wider plans — internal eyes only.

confidential, kagep-kahof: Druokax Systems plans to lower the Ulaath list price by 53 percent in March.